Abstract
Experimental results are reported of the subjective assessment of picture impairments due to cell loss in asynchronous transfer mode (ATM) networks. It is shown that the CCIR 5-grade impairment scaling method is suitable for the kind of impairment found in overload conditions. The results serve to quantify the ´forgiveness´ effect, which influences the subjective quality of the decoded pictures. Some suggestions are made as to how this can be taken into consideration in packet video quality assessment.
